... Read moreLag can significantly affect gameplay in Sonic titles, creating frustrating experiences for players. This issue is not uncommon, and many gamers have reported varying degrees of lag while playing different titles. Community forums are buzzing with discussions about optimizing performance settings and troubleshooting common errors that lead to lag. Here are some tips to reduce lag in Sonic games: 1. **Check Your Connection**: Ensure you have a stable internet connection, as online gameplay is often impacted by lags, such as long ping times. 2. **Optimize Game Settings**: Lowering graphics settings can help reduce lag, particularly on older hardware. Adjust texture quality, shadow detail, and resolution for smoother performance. 3. **Update Software**: Keep your game and device software updated to the latest versions to benefit from performance improvements and bug fixes. 4. **Close Background Applications**: Free up system resources by closing unnecessary applications running in the background, thus enhancing the game performance. 5. **Consult Community Guides**: Many players have published comprehensive guides detailing their experiences with lag and how they resolved it. These can serve as a valuable resource.
